Four Redbird Football Games Set To Air On CSN Chicago

CHICAGO, Ill. – Illinois State Athletics will continue to maintain its television footprint in the Chicago media market for the 2016 Redbird football season, after the program signed a new four-game agreement with Comcast SportsNet Chicago, whose regional television base reaches 4.9 million homes.

Comcast SportsNet, which is the television home for the most games and most comprehensive coverage of the Chicago Blackhawks, Bulls, Cubs and White Sox, is available on most cable outlets in the state of Illinois, as well as on DirectTV and Dish Network.  

Redbird fans who receive Comcast SportsNet will be able to watch the 105th meeting of the Mid-America Classic on Family Weekend against Eastern Illinois, which is set to be played on Sept. 17 at Hancock Stadium. The game continues the oldest FCS football rivalry in the state of Illinois and the 13th-oldest at the FCS level, with the Panthers leading the all-time series, 52-43-9.  

CSN will then televise both contests of a two-game home stand, which begins Oct. 8 with a Homecoming matchup against Youngstown State and an in-state rivalry matchup versus Southern Illinois on Oct. 15.  The final game of the four-game package will be the Oct. 29 matchup against South Dakota State.
